Exceptional Impact Resistance: Polycarbonate Glass for Critical Environments

Polycarbonate glass has gained significant recognition in critical environments due to its remarkable shock resistance. Unlike traditional glass materials, polycarbonate offers exceptional strength, able to withstand high-velocity impacts and resist shattering. This inherent attribute makes it ideal for applications where safety is paramount, such as in security structures, aerospace components, and protective equipment. Furthermore, polycarbonate's lightweight nature and flexibility allow for its integration into a wide range of designs without compromising performance.

In situations demanding utmost protection, polycarbonate glass provides an invaluable barrier, safeguarding against potential hazards and ensuring the safety of personnel and equipment. Its remarkable impact resistance coupled with other desirable properties makes polycarbonate glass a preferred choice for critical environments where safety and reliability are non-negotiable.
